Very disturbing list of domains:
Several other domains also appear to have been seized including 2009jerseys.com, nfljerseysupply.com, throwbackguy.com, cartoon77.com, lifetimereplicas.com, handbag9.com, handbagcom.com and dvdprostore.com.
Unless someone does not have authority to sell NFL licensed products, I can see the reason. I can also see handbagcom.com being shuttered.
But the disturbing part is by what method or authority or complaint system is this done? If there was a legal process conducted prior to these being pulled and that legal process was completely ignored, I can see this as being the ultimatum.
This is going to make those typo and TM names very risky to own or purchase.
